Handover note — Quillgate health checks

Passing this to you before I rotate off. Plugin authors keep asking why their endpoints get marked unhealthy behind the Verdanport balancer: it probes the shallow path, not the deep one, and the grace window is shorter than most expect. The active probe settings are listed below.

config for yahop-tafof:
[rusir]
port = 11211
region = upper-1
host = rusir.torvacloud.test
team = ulaax
timeout_ms = 1500
retries = 8

Account recovery for Quillbox render nodes. If template rendering p95 exceeds 400ms, check the partial cache hit rate first. Below 80% means the warmer job died; restart it via the ops console. Recovering the warmer's service account requires re-auth through the Fennel gateway. Use the recovery passphrase below when the gateway prompts for it.

strongbox words: sorir-belvan-rusix-ulays-ralmir-praix-eliir-tamax-praael-druael-julir-tamius-jorir

Hi Tomas — handover for the Fenwick serverless release. This build addresses the cold-start regression in the order-intake handlers: we now pre-warm four instances per region and pin the runtime snapshot, which cut p99 init latency roughly in half on staging. Watch the warm-pool metrics for the first hour after promotion. The deploy pipeline requires the release to be signed before the Bramblehook gateway will route traffic to it. The signing key follows.

rollout seal: bky4_x7Gc